A Huawei code calculator is a software tool (or script) that generates security codes, such as network unlock codes (NCK), flash codes, or bootloader unlock codes, for Huawei devices. Unlike a universal password that works on any device, a "universal master code" is generated based on the input of a specific IMEI. In essence, the calculator takes an IMEI number as input, runs it through a proprietary algorithmic process to produce a unique code for that device.
